Biography
Serge Harb, MD, is a staff cardiologist in the Section of Cardiovascular Imaging in the Robert and Suzanne Tomsich Department of Cardiovascular Medicine at the Sydell and Arnold Miller Family Heart, Vascular & Thoracic Institute. He sees patients at the Cleveland Clinic main campus.
Dr. Harb has completed all of his internal medicine, cardiology, and advanced cardiac imaging training at Cleveland Clinic main campus. He is a specialist in multimodality cardiovascular imaging and has obtained the highest level of training in all cardiac imaging modalities, including echocardiography, nuclear cardiology, cardiovascular computed tomography (CT) and cardiovascular magnetic resonance imaging (MRI).
Specialty Interests: Valvular heart disease, advanced cardiac imaging, cardiac three-dimensional printing, and evaluation of patients for minimally invasive cardiac procedures, aortic disease, infiltrative heart disease, and ischemic and non-ischemic heart disease. Dr. Harb has a special interest in advanced cardiac imaging and in the evaluation and guidance of minimally invasive procedures.
Number of Patients Treated: The Section of Cardiac Imaging in the Tomsich Department of Cardiovascular Medicine is one of the largest and most experienced in the country. The staff reads and interprets nearly 50,000 images every year. In addition, the physicians in the section are also experts in the treatment and long-term management of many types of heart conditions such as pericarditis, rheumatic heart disease and heart valve disease.
Education and Training: Dr. Harb earned his medical degree from Saint Joseph University School of Medicine in Beirut, Lebanon, graduating with honors as class valedictorian and receiving multiple merit scholarships. He served his internal medicine residency at Cleveland Clinic during which he won the residency research activity award. He continued his cardiology fellowship training at Cleveland Clinic and was the recipient of the Wilson Foundation scholarship. He then completed his subspecialty training at Cleveland Clinic in advanced cardiac imaging and was appointed chief fellow in his last year of training. Dr. Harb joined the Cleveland Clinic medical staff in 2018.
Research, Publications and Speaking: Dr. Harb has authored more than 20 manuscripts published in peer-reviewed medical and cardiology journals. He has also contributed book chapters to several cardiology textbooks and manuals. Dr. Harb has been invited to present his research at national and international cardiology meetings and scientific sessions. He won multiple awards including the top investigator award from the American Society of Echocardiography, the first place award from the American College of Cardiology (Ohio Chapter competition), the best poster award from the European Society of Cardiology, and numerous travel grants, from the American Society of Echocardiography and the American College of Cardiology. He was elected by the American Society of Echocardiography as a member of the Rising Star Task Force. He has also been recognized in clinical education and has received awards for excellence in teaching 3 years in a row.
